Connected TV and OTT Advertising in Port Victoria

In Port Victoria, local advertising was traditionally handled through regional TV stations and local cable environments. Today, many residents spend more time with streaming services on smart TVs and connected devices. That makes CTV, OTT, and streaming advertising increasingly relevant for brands that want to reach audiences in Port Victoria with modern, localized campaigns. Using IP-based geo-targeting, ads can be delivered specifically to households in the area, even when the content itself runs on national streaming platforms. This gives advertisers the ability to combine the premium feel of television with the precision of digital local targeting.

How to create effective ad messages in Port Victoria

When advertising in Port Victoria, your message should feel authentic, local, and easy to understand. In smaller communities, relatable and straightforward communication performs best.

Here are some ways to create a strong local connection in your ads:

Looking across the jetty and sheltered waters, Port Victoria naturally lends itself to creative that feels breezy, family-friendly and rooted in Yorke Peninsula fishing culture. The town’s old wheat port heritage adds character, but for most advertising the strongest cues are beach holidays, squid and whiting trips, caravan stays and the easy pace of a coastal stop people return to year after year. Visuals should include the jetty, boats at dawn, kids on the sand, weatherboard holiday homes and golden evening light. The tone should be cheerful, relaxed and authentic, with a dash of nostalgia for summer routines and simpler pleasures. Messaging can reference time on the water, fresh seafood, local café stops and the appeal of a no-fuss getaway where everybody can unwind. This is a good fit for brands wanting to sound approachable and local-minded. Keep the language natural and sunny, as if speaking to people who know exactly where they’ll be spending the next long weekend.
